The Creation of Java

Java was created in 1991 at Sun Microsystems, Inc by James Gosling, Patrick Naughton, Chris Warth, Ed Frank, and Mike Sheridan. The first functioning version took eighteen months to produce. This language, formerly known as “Oak,” was renamed “Java” in 1995.

Many more individuals contributed to the design and progress of the language between the initial implementation of Oak in the fall of 1992 and the public introduction of Java in the spring of 1995. Bill Joy, Arthur van Hoff, Jonathan Payne, Frank Yellin, and Tim Lindholm were major contributions to the prototype’s development.

Surprisingly, the Internet was not the original push behind Java! The fundamental impetus was the need for a platform-independent (architecture-neutral) language that can be used to write software that could be embedded in various consumer electrical products such as microwave ovens and remote controls. As you may expect, several different types of CPUs are employed as controllers.

The issue with C and C++ (and most other programming languages) is that they are meant to be built for a specific purpose. Although it is feasible to create a C++ program for almost any type of CPU, doing so necessitates the use of a full C++ compiler designed specifically for that CPU. The issue is that compilers are costly and time-consuming to develop.

In an attempt to discover such a solution, Gosling and others began developing a portable, platform-independent language that could be used to generate code that could operate on several CPUs in a range of contexts. This endeavor resulted in the development of Java Books. The Evolution of Java

Java’s original release was nothing less than revolutionary, yet it did not signal the end of Java’s period of fast progress. Unlike most other software systems, which tend to settle into a pattern of minor, incremental changes, Java has continued to advance at a breakneck speed. Java 1.1 was built shortly after the release of Java 1.0 by the Java designers. The innovations added by Java 1.1 were more essential and significant than the minimal revision number increase would lead you to believe.

Many new library pieces were added in Java 1.1, as well as changes to the way events are handled and the configuration of many features of the 1.0 library. It also deprecated (made unnecessary) certain features specified in Java 1.0. As a result, Java 1.1 was both added to and deleted from the original specification’s properties. 

Java 2 was the next major release, with the “2” indicating “second generation.” The release of Java 2 was a watershed moment, heralding the start of Java’s “modern age.” Version number 1.2 was assigned to the initial release of Java 2. It may appear strange that the first version of Java 2 utilized version number 1.2. The reason for this is that it initially related to the internal version number of the Java libraries, but was later expanded to refer to the full release.

Java 2 brought support for a number of new features, including Swing and the Collections Framework, as well as improvements to the Java Virtual Machine and other development tools. There were also a couple of deprecations in Java 2. The most significant impact was on the Thread class, where the methods suspend(), resume(), and halt() were abandoned.

Head First Java

Head First Java

Published in 2003

Kathy Sierra and Bert Bates are the authors.

Description: The title of the book accurately describes it. If you are typically unknown, these Java books are a good place to start especially this one. It teaches the topics using simple language and real-world situations. It is a popular book among Java programmers, but it has one disadvantage: it has not been updated since Java 5.0. It also covers fundamental programming ideas as well as advanced topics like socket programming, distributed programming using RMI, and so on.

Features of this book:

  • The principles are explained visually, which distinguishes it from other publications.
  • It includes riddles, great graphics, mysteries, and soul-searching conversations with renowned Java objects to keep you entertained in a variety of ways.
  • The images in the book are depicted as comic illustrations, allowing the reader to readily comprehend the principles.

Java The Complete Reference

Java The Complete Reference

Officially published in 1997.

Herbert Schildt is the author.

Description: It is one of the most recommended Java books by many Java programmers and is also recommended by institutions for their students. It is an excellent book for those who are just starting with Java. It thoroughly covers fundamental Java topics such as programming ideas, keywords, Java language syntaxes, Java 8 API, JavaBeans, servlets, applets, swing, and so on. It is widely accessible on the market and may be downloaded in PDF format. The book is almost 1000 pages long. Its popularity stems from its simple language.

Each idea is described in full with real-world examples in this book, and at the end of each chapter, there is a collection of multiple-choice problems similar to those seen in competitive exams.

Effective Java

Effective Java

Originally released in 2001.

Joshua Bloch is the author.

Description: It is the authoritative handbook to the Java platform. Its detailed explanations and descriptions of each subject reveal what to do, what not to do, and why. If you already know the fundamentals of Java programming, you can choose these types of Java books for in-depth instruction. A novel design pattern, annotations, autoboxing, and other subjects are covered in the book. All of these topics are described clearly and concisely, with appropriate examples.

Java Puzzlers: Traps, Pitfalls, and Corner Cases

Java Puzzlers Traps Pitfalls and Corner Cases

Initially published in 2005.

Joshua Bloch and Neal Grafter are the authors.

Description: Java Puzzler distinguishes itself from other Java publications. In the form of puzzles, the Java books thoroughly illustrate the inner workings of the Java programming language. It has almost 500 problems based on Java programming. Because this is an advanced-level book, you must be conversant with the Java programming language. It is the finest Java book for brain training.

Features of this book:

  • There are puzzles in each chapter.
  • The puzzles are roughly organized by the features they employ, and thorough solutions are provided for each challenge.
  • At the back of the book, a useful catalog of traps and dangers gives a clear classification for future reference.

The Java™ Programming Language

The Java Programming Language

Initially published in 2005.

Ken Arnold is the author. David Holmes and James Gosling

Description: The JavaTM Programming Language, Fourth Edition is the authoritative educational introduction to the Java language and important libraries, as well as a must-have reference for all programmers, including those with substantial expertise. It pulls together insights that can only be obtained from the authors of Java: insights that will help you build high-quality software.

The rewritten fourth edition of The JavaTM Programming Language, authored by the developers of the JavaTM programming language, is an invaluable reference for both novice and expert programmers. It is among the best Java books.

Previous versions were used by developers all around the globe to quickly get a solid grasp of the Java programming language, its design aims, and how to utilize it most effectively in real-world development. Ken Arnold, James Gosling, and David Holmes have revised this classic to reflect the significant improvements in JavaTM 2 Standard Edition 5.0 (J2SETM 5.0). The authors cover most classes in Java‘s primary packages, java.lang.*, java.util, and java.io, in-depth, with useful examples.

Several new chapters and important parts have been added, and all chapters have been updated to follow current best practices for developing strong, efficient, and maintainable Java software.

Features of this Java book are:

  • New chapters cover the most powerful new language features introduced in J2SE 5.0, generics, enums, and annotations.
  • Modifications to classes and methods to reflect the inclusion of generics
  • Significant new sections on assertions and regular expressions have been added.
  • Coverage includes all new language features, including autoboxing and variable argument methods, as well as improved for-loop and covariant return types.
  • Coverage of important new classes like Formatter and Scanner
